Trading Fours is a music podcast that focuses on musicians in Kansas City and around the world. Your host is Jamie Green. Jamie is a guitarist who has played in numerous bands you've never heard of! It is a casual conversation with musicians about their craft and their creative process. "Trading Fours" is a musical term that means each musician plays a solo for 4 measures. Jamie is the son of a jazz trumpeter and music educator.

Have you ever wondered what it would have been like to watch the Beatles write music? Or watch Fleetwood Mac record Rumours? Well if you're Jenny Boyd - you don't have wonder, you lived it! She's today's guest today. She is the author of "Icons of Rock: In their own words." Jenny has interviewed just about everybody in music to explore their creative process. Jenny was married to Mick Fleetwood not once, but twice. She has lived in the world of rock 'n roll for over 50 years, and she's a great interviewer. Great chat, do it up! https://thejennyboyd.com/

Have you ever wanted to do something for a really long time - but have never pulled the trigger? Well a lot of us have - and today's guest is no different. You probably know Tommy Taylor for being an amazing drummer for Eric Johnson, Christopher Cross and many others. But Tommy has always wanted to create his own music - and at age 66, he has done just that! Tommy's new album is his debut album of his music - where he wrote the songs and sang lead vocals on the tracks. We had an amazing chat about the new music, growing up in Texas, playing with Eric Johnson, hanging out with Stevie Ray Vaughan and much much more!
